Output e86b409e665c26158c5eb0abd25a01d26d92b0f5c8e5e84e4e3257c89bd13808:0

value
5923701
script pubkey
OP_0 OP_PUSHBYTES_20 532ef5a203b3b8d05146c57ea107e09b62fae0bf
address
bc1q2vh0tgsrkwudq52xc4l2zplqnd304c9l73r592
transaction
e86b409e665c26158c5eb0abd25a01d26d92b0f5c8e5e84e4e3257c89bd13808
spent
true